WebJun 20, 2024 · X-ray tube operates by generating a stream of electrons by heating up a cathode (tungsten) filament. This stream of electrons is directed at high speed at a high voltage Anode disc (usually tungsten). X-radiation is produced due to the electrons’ interaction with the atomic particles of the Anode. WebHow does an x-ray tube generate x-rays? X-rays are commonly produced in X-ray tubes by accelerating electrons through a potential difference (a voltage drop) and directing them onto a target material (i.e. tungsten). The incoming electrons release X-rays as they slowdown in the target (braking radiation or bremsstrahlung).
